Clara A. Custer was born November 16, 1856 and died June 16, 1912, age 55 years and 7 months. She was married May 5, 1878 to Joseph M. Blackburn, who preceded her to the spirit world May 16, 1892. There were born to this union 8 children, four of whom died in infancy. An adopted son also died at the age of 5 years. The living children are John R. , Oak E., Nora N. and Lora R. Blackburn, all of Millwood, W. Va., the residence of their mother. They with six brothers, one sister, her mother, Sarah J. Custer, who resided with her, and a host of friends (For to know her was to love her) are left to mourn her departure.
Mrs. Blacksburn was converted in early life and joined the M. E. church in which she remained a member to the time of her death. She lived a life worthy of the vacation whein she was called and died in the triumphs of a living faith.
Her means and interest in the cause of Our Master made possible the erection of the church where she now lays Millwood M. E. Church a silent recipient of the tributes friends may bring. So long as the building stands it stands as a monument to her name.
